  • RMINIT.ZIP (--link--) [May 5 1996]

    Combat action tracking program for WIN95 by BrReynolds@aol.com. This program was designed for GM's who are not using the Standard Rolemaster Combat System. What it does is allows DM's to assign a length of time it takes to complete an action. Actions like Melee attack, cast spell, prep, hex facing change, movement, and so on. Also it keeps track of what the players minus to movement DB and OB are so when they do attack, move, or have to defend themselve appropriate minus is tracked. It keeps track on how many hits they have and what conditions they have. A condition could be anything from bleeding to being invisible to being stunned.

  • builder.zip (--link--) [Nov 21 1996]

    The Fantasy World Builder(tm) is aimed to aid fantasy role-playing game masters in the design of a campaign QUICKLY. Requiring a 386 MS-DOS based PC with 585k conventional RAM, and 2meg of Expanded Memory (EMS), 256 color VGA, and a Microsoft Compatible mouse, the Fantasy World Builder requires little time to get a finished product. Using a graphical point-and-click interface with minimal keyboard use, the program will generate random maps for 2 types of dungeons (natural or cut), cities, and terrain. Whenever a city or dungeon is created, information on the new creation is stored on disk. When a world map is generated, you are given the option to include the previously generated file information in the generation of the world. This allows the computer to randomly place the cities and dungeons in the world. Copyright (c) 1996 Perry Horner P_HORNER@ASU.EDU
